Hi all !
  Does Lexra's CPU LX4280 has MMU. I've found from dateaheet LX4280 that
there is only SMMU (S stands for Simple) which does not include TLB and
exceptions related to that.
  I've noticed port for lexra (among others also for LX4280) on cvs. Is it
possible to run linux on that kind of processor, and if so will it manage
user space application as it should  with mmu.
